PHP正規表示式

2022-06-11 01:39:10 字數 2549 閱讀 7805

我們最經常遇到的驗證,就是電子郵件位址驗證。**上常見。各種網頁指令碼也都常用「正規表示式」(regular expression)對我們輸入的電子郵件位址進行驗證,判斷是否合法。有的還能分解出使用者名稱和網域名稱。現在用php語言實現一下電子郵件位址驗證程式,用的是php正規表示式庫。

源**如下:

<?php

header ( "content-type: text/html; charset=utf-8");

$reply = "";

if ( isset($_post["email_address"]) )

(\\.[a-z])?)$/i";

if ( preg_match( $pattern, $email_address

) )

else

}?>

doctype html public "-//w3c//dtd xhtml 1.0 transitional//en" ""

>

<

html

xmlns

=""lang

="zh"

xml:lang

="zh"

>

<

head

>

<

title

>電子郵件位址驗證程式

title

>

head

>

<

body

style

="text-align: center;"

>

<

h1>電子郵件位址驗證程式

h1>

<

form

action

="#"

method

="post"

>

<

input

name

="email_address"

type

="text"

style

="width: 300px;"

/><

br />

<

input

type

="submit"

value

="驗證電子郵件位址"

/>

form

>

<?php

echo

$reply

;?>

body

>

html

>

我們最經常遇到的驗證,就是電子郵件位址驗證。**上常見。各種網頁指令碼也都常用「正規表示式」(regular expression)對我們輸入的電子郵件位址進行驗證,判斷是否合法。有的還能分解出使用者名稱和網域名稱。現在用php語言實現一下電子郵件位址驗證程式,用的是php正規表示式庫。

源**如下:

<?php

header ( "content-type: text/html; charset=utf-8");

$reply = "";

if ( isset($_post["email_address"]) )

(\\.[a-z])?)$/i";

if ( preg_match( $pattern, $email_address

) )

else

}?>

doctype html public "-//w3c//dtd xhtml 1.0 transitional//en" ""

>

<

html

xmlns

=""lang

="zh"

xml:lang

="zh"

>

<

head

>

<

title

>電子郵件位址驗證程式

title

>

head

>

<

body

style

="text-align: center;"

>

<

h1>電子郵件位址驗證程式

h1>

<

form

action

="#"

method

="post"

>

<

input

name

="email_address"

type

="text"

style

="width: 300px;"

/><

br />

<

input

type

="submit"

value

="驗證電子郵件位址"

/>

form

>

<?php

echo

$reply

;?>

body

>

html

>

php正規表示式詳解,PHP正規表示式使用詳解

操作符 描述 轉義符 圓括號和方括號 限定符 anymetacharacter 位置和順序 或 操作 全部符號解釋 字元 描述 將下乙個字元標記為乙個特殊字元 或乙個原義字元 或乙個 向後引用 或乙個八進位制轉義符。例如,n 匹配字元 n n 匹配乙個換行符。序列 匹配 而 則匹配 匹配輸入字串的開...

PHP正規表示式

php正規表示式的定義 用於描述字元排列和匹配模式的一種語法規則。它主要用於字串的模式分割 匹配 查詢及替換操作。php中的正則函式 php中有兩套正則函式,兩者功能差不多,分別為 一套是由pcre perl compatible regular expression 庫提供的。使用 preg 為字...

PHP正規表示式

今天起,會開始弄乙個php教程系列文章.主要是針對正規表示式的.大概的內容排序是這樣安排的 1.php 中的正規表示式 2.八個實用的php正規表示式 3.如何書寫更易閱讀的php正規表示式 4.半小時精通正規表示式 5.正則在文章採集系統中的應用及常見問題答疑 6.更多策劃中 投稿,完善本系列,讓...